Springfield Road is in Carlisle and in Cumberland district. CA1 3QX is located in the Harraby North elect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Carlisle.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

During the 2021 census, the educational qualifications of residents across the UK were as follows: 18.2% had no qualifications, 9.6% had 1-4 GCSEs, 13.4% had 5 or more GCSEs and 1-2 A/AS Levels, 16.9% had 2 or more A Levels, 33.8% held a degree (or equivalent), and 5.4% had completed an apprenticeship.
In the area around CA1 3QX this area, 28.4% of residents have no qualifications. This is significantly higher than the UK average of 18.2%. This area stands out for its low percentage of residents with higher education degree. The UK average is 33.8%, while in this area it is 19.8%.
| 2011 | 2021 | 10y change (pp) | UK Average | postcode vs UK (pp) |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| No qualifications | 44% | 28.4% | -15.6% | 18.2% | 10.2% |
| 1-4 GCSEs or Equivalent | 14.5% | 10.7% | -3.8% | 9.6% | 1.1% |
| 5 or more GCSEs, an A-Level or 1-2 AS Levels | 20.7% | 13.2% | -7.5% | 13.4% | -0.2% |
| Apprenticeship | 0% | 7.6% | 7.6% | 5.3% | 2.3% |
| HNC, HND or 2+ A Levels | 7.8% | 18.8% | 11.0% | 16.9% | 1.9% |
| Degree or Similar | 8.3% | 19.8% | 11.5% | 33.8% | -14.0% |
| Other | 4.7% | 1.5% | -3.2% | 2.8% | -1.3% |

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Springfield Road was 158.8 per 1,000 residents, which is 100.8% higher than the Botcherby average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.
Springfield Road has the 17th highest crime rate of 62 local areas in Botcherby and the 90th highest crime rate of 917 local areas in Cumberland .
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 111.9 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has risen by about 2.0%.
